Output 3475a22585a35a450e3f1f9a3a6bb9a34758cdca40ee12d10d272c1208aa2bd7:4

value
290617816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c98e91ae01054f0498247cdcbaaa445754127fb OP_EQUAL
address
3EWRhp5EXX6DutbqM8HXT4wdwSVrkBNzZX
transaction
3475a22585a35a450e3f1f9a3a6bb9a34758cdca40ee12d10d272c1208aa2bd7
spent
true